Output c8caa675698138e21669a226ce25015737d840cb1c0e19c12b67641ebd6808fa:0

value
5916694284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d688d63bd1d1e8fa333974911e56dd327273737e OP_EQUAL
address
3MFNTBme3H8jxa4JFDSTHt5qKaKbAdHN27
transaction
c8caa675698138e21669a226ce25015737d840cb1c0e19c12b67641ebd6808fa
spent
true